
The United Nations University (UNU) is a global think tank and postgraduate teaching organization within the United Nations System. UNU engages in policy-relevant research, capacity development, and knowledge dissemination in furtherance of the purposes and principles of the United Nations. UNU-WIDER is a leading international development economics think tank. The Institute provides economic analysis and policy advice with the aim of promoting sustainable and equitable development for all. UNU-WIDER has an established and long-standing presence in Mozambique through its embedded support to government institutions, including under the Inclusive Growth in Mozambique (IGM) programme and the Strengthening Capacity to Access Climate Finance (FORÇA) project.
